Exercising doesn’t have to be redundant and boring. There are lots of ways to get into shape without making it a chore and there are a few ways to trick yourself into thinking that you’re not actually working out, when you are.
Park Far Away From The Entrance
It can be so tempting to want to get the first parking spot available, BUT it may not always be the best option for you if you’re needing to burn off the extra calories.
Instead, try parking in the very back of the lot and walk to and from the door. Bonus points if you walk around the store first, before grabbing what you need and heading out.
Exercise While Your Kids Play
Trips to the park don’t have to be solely for your kids. While your kids enjoy the playground, you can easily get a workout right next to the play yard. It’s a great way for the entire family to stay active and your body will thank you. You’ll also see improvements in your mood.
